ClientExec nulled top refers to a pirated or cracked version of the ClientExec software. The term "nulled" in the software piracy context means that the software's licensing or activation mechanisms have been bypassed or disabled, often through hacking or patching. This allows users to access the software without purchasing a legitimate license or adhering to the terms and conditions set by the software developers.
